          Hi Patrick,

          The photos aren't great. They look blue but I'm assuming the ribbon is in fact black? From this distance, on the reverse, it looks like metal thread as opposed to cotton but closeups with your camera's macro setting, or scans would be better. How long is it - looks to be about 150 cm?

          Having said that, pending the clarifications above, based on these views the preliminary impression is a good private purchase full-length KM tally in Metallfaden. But really need better views since the washed out photo from a distance actually makes it look more like cotton thread from the front...

            Nope, I think it is blue looks like a non official "sweetheart" souvenier tally.

            script should be cotton. have seen these in various colours for ships but don't recall seeing a non ship one before
